The Role
Put M in every household's pocket. India runs on Android - across a thousand devices, price points, and network conditions. You'll build M's native Android app from scratch and make a real-time, AI-driven, conversational experience feel effortless.

What you'll do
- Build M's native Android app - daily-use, real-time, built to last.
- Make conversation feel instant: streaming replies, voice notes, well-timed notifications.
- Win on real-world Android - device sprawl, flaky networks, memory, battery.
- Own the craft bar: an app that feels fast and trustworthy on a budget phone.
- Ship for launch with Backend and Design, and shape the roadmap.

What We're Looking For
- 3-4 years building and shipping native Android apps (Kotlin) to the Play Store.
- You've fought and won the real-device, real-network battles.
- Comfortable with real-time data and messaging-style UIs.
- You own features end-to-end.

Bonus Qualifications
- Built chat, voice, or other real-time-heavy apps.
- Worked with AI or streaming responses on mobile.
- You treat performance on low-end devices as a feature, not an afterthought.

30 / 60 / 90-Day Expectations
- 30 days: shipping to production; multiple features merged.
- 60 days: you own a major slice of the app, and it's in customers' hands.
- 90 days: the craft bar and architecture in your area are yours.
